The Abandoned Empress Chapter 104

Chapter 104: Chapter 104

As I got carried away with the crown prince's love that I had never received, but later abandoned by him, I committed the same cruel thing to you like I suffered in the past.

I broke your heart too much by avoiding you, but at the same time I didn't want to lose you.

I really don't deserve to be loved by you.

“Don't cry. I didn't say that to make you cry, Tia. ”

“… ”

“I'm okay. I'm sorry to have given you a burden.”

“Allen.”

“… Let's go, Tia. It's time we went back, ” he said with a hoarse voice, turning his head from me a bit. Can I stand up like him? I was afraid I might hurt his feelings again by failing to speak my mind clearly. Although he wanted me to allow him to continue to call me ‘my lady,' I couldn't now.

Allendis looked up at me, when I shook my head, signalling my refusal. He closed his lips and stood up. He grabbed my hands and raised me up and said with a trembling voice, “Aren't you going to look at me?”

“I… ”

“It's already dark. I can't let you go back home alone now. If you don't mind, just allow me to escort you back home today.”

“… Sure.”

I could hardly hear Allendis' reply because he spoke feebly.

When I saw the red and white flowers in my arms, I felt so sorry, sad and guilty again that I was choked up with more tears. I started walking while trying to turn away from the flowers.

I heard the sound of him trudging behind me with a heavy heart.

Was it because of the mellow autumn? The days were getting shorter.

When I arrived at the commercial district where nobles lived, I saw a street wide enough to allow several wagons to pass at once. As it was getting dark, the young ladies of the nobles and noblewomen were busy getting back home here and there. Lots of wagons with various crests of the noble families were constantly driving on the well-paved streets, with horsemen shouting ‘Giddy-up!” and whipping the horses.

With the sky beginning to turn gray and darkness falling down, I was walking blankly.

Was it because I was exhausted? I felt hazy as if I was wandering about in a dream.

My head was a mess. I mechanically walked along with Allendis next to me. I didn't even know how long I walked or where I headed. Nothing came to my mind. I felt as if I was moving as led by somebody.

How long did I walk like that? My foot suddenly struck against something. I stopped at the moment and looked down. Something round was there at my feet. I bent over and picked up the round object.

‘What do I call this?'

Obviously, I knew its name, but my dumb brain couldn't recall it. I thought hard about it, spinning it in my hands.

“Dang it! Can't you strike it right? Why are you telling me to pick it up all the time?”

A small child came running to me, grumbling something. Looking for something here and there, he finally found it in my hand. After hesitating a bit, he looked at me and Allendis and opened his mouth, “Excuse me, lady.”

“… ”

“That's my ball… ”

‘Right. It was a ball. ‘

I was very happy when I could recall the name of the round object, which I couldn't a moment ago, no matter how hard I thought of. I stopped spinning it. Why didn't its name occur to me?”

“Young miss?”

“… . ”

“That ball…”

I heard him saying something to me, but I could not understand properly. I still felt as if I was wandering in a dream.

“I'm sorry, noble lady.”

“… ”

“I will never do it again. So please give the ball back to me. If I don't get it back, my brother will scold me.”

It took some time for me to understand what he said to me as I couldn't think straight.

In the end, the child who checked my expression burst into tears. His crying hovered into my ears. Only then did I come to my senses as if I was awakened from my dream.

I looked down at the crying boy. He, who seemed to be a son of a commoner family, was neatly dressed up. I quickly smiled brightly at him and gave the ball to him.

“Oh, it's yours. Take it. ”

“Ah… ”

“Here it is. You said your brother would scold you if you didn't get it back.”

I smiled again at the boy looking blankly at me and gave him the ball. Rubbing his eyes, he took it with a smile.

“Thank you, sweet gentle lady!”

“You're welcome. Take care!”

I thought, watching him running back in a cheerful mood.

‘Gentle noble lady? Gentle? Well, I could look gentle like you said.'

‘Love and care for your people. Even if you throw your body at the last moment, try to win their hearts by rendering a service to them while maintaining your composure. Take care of your subordinates' pitiful situation and be warm and kind to them because we are nobles reigning over them.' I was fed up with the motto. But the boy, who didn't know anything about my situation, might have thought I was a gentle lady by just seeing my ceremonial smile.

But why is the commoner boy hanging around here? There is no place for the commoners between the restaurant in a noble business district and my house in the nobles' district.

As I felt strange, I looked around. Stranger roads and buildings came into my view.

‘Where am I?'

When I was moving around the capital, I wasn't familiar with the roads because I usually used a wagon, but I was not in a noble district. Did I take the wrong way? As I was walking in a daze, I didn't know where I was heading.

What about Allendis? Didn't he also know that he had taken the wrong way?

“Allen?”

“… Huh?”

“I think we took the wrong way.”

“Ah!”

He almost resumed walking away when I said that. Only then did he look around as if he noticed something strange. His emerald eyes were looking at me for a while.

In the end, he spoke with an awkward smile, “… I'm sorry, Tia. ”

“Ugh?”

“I think we took the wrong way as I was absent-minded. It looks like we took the opposite road.”

“I see. That's how I felt.”

My heart ached, but I just nodded. Given that he never forgot what he saw or read once, he must have been so distressed and absent-minded as to take the wrong way. Biting my lip as I was stricken with a sense of guilt again, I walked in the opposite direction.

Although I quicked my steps to get back home, I barely arrived at my house after it was completely dark because I took the wrong way and turned back.

“Good night, Tia.”

“Good night, Allen.”

“…Tia. ”

“Huh.”

“Whew…”

He let out a sigh after hesitating for a while, which seemed to indicate he felt dejected and frustrated. As I couldn't see his green eyes, I just tapped my feet on the ground, looking down.

I felt helpless and frustrated, too.

“Never mind. Take care.”

“… Okay. Be careful, Allen. ”

Without seeing him walking away, I stepped into the house, escorted by the house knight at the door. I felt like looking back, so I took a few steps before looking back at him. He was still standing there right outside the gate, looking at me.

When I saw his shadow under the torch that lit the entrance to the mansion, tears sprang to my eyes. I turned quickly, covering my mouth with one hand. And I never looked back again until I entered the mansion.

“My lady, you look so pale. You told me you were going to a festival. What happened?”

“Lina.”

“What's going on, my lady? Did you quarrel with him?”

“…Sorry. I want to be alone.”

“What the heck… Whew, got it. I'm on standby outside. So, if you need help, please call me. ”

“Sure, thanks.”

As soon as she left, I threw myself on the bed. My tears began to fall in big drops quickly, which I held back because I could not cry heartily in front of Allendis. When I was left alone in my room now, I could cry freely.

I hugged my pillow and buried my face. I cried my fill, biting the pillow cover so that my crying could not be heard outside the room. With a sense of guilt, I hated and blamed myself for rejecting the confession of my closest friend, so I cried and cried for a long time.
